WyldChess 1.5 Released (04/06/17)
Re: WyldChess Wyld
Changes:
-> Added Syzygy EGTB support
-> Improved LMR (in part thanks to Ed Schroeder!)
-> Added history heuristic
-> Fixed TT mate-score bugs
-> Better futility pruning
-> Begun switching to c++ for easier coding(and possibly smaller binaries for windows)
This version I mainly modified search without changing evaluation much. Self testing shows significant(100+) elo gains at 40moves/90s and a little less at 40/10s+0.1s but I doubt it will work out better than ~50elo going by the CCRL list.

WyldChess 1.51 Released (03/07/17)

Re: WyldChess Wyld

This is a patch release for WyldChess 1.5.
It contains the patches for the following bugs:
The Xboard mode bug where it would play illegal moves when starting from a given FEN/EPD.
Windows timeouts (by increasing default move overhead to 30ms instead of previous 10ms).
It also contains a new UCI/Xboard option: MoveOverhead, which allows the user to set the amount of time WyldChess should reserve from it's usual allotment of time for each move. This allows further customization in case the 30ms reservation proves too little.
